  • @Kathy -- There is as much warning as possible. The police drive through communities to tell each house that they are under mandatory or recommended evacuation. Because of the speed of some fires, there isn't often much time to gather stuff. However, I'm sure any reasonable person who might possibly be in danger, but not yet ordered to evacuate, has started packing their most valuable stuff (family photos, etc.) Lots of people who live in areas prone to wildfires have a list of what they want to take and have made preparations long in advance, including evacuation drills.
